The properties of a filter control are:
Property Name | Description | |||
---|---|---|---|---|
Geometry | ||||
Height | Specifies the height of the object, in inches or centimeters. Enter a numeric value to change the height.
Data type: Float |
|||
Width | Specifies the width of the object, in inches or centimeters. Enter a numeric value to change the width.
Data type: Float |
|||
Color | ||||
Background | Specifies the background color of the object. Choose a color from the drop-down list, enter a hexadecimal RGB value (for example, 0xff0000), or select Custom from the drop-down list to specify the color.
Data type: String |
|||
Foreground | Specifies the foreground color of the object. Choose a color from the drop-down list, enter a hexadecimal RGB value (for example, 0xff0000), or select Custom from the drop-down list to specify the color.
Data type: String |
|||
CSS | ||||
Class | Specifies a CSS class to be applied to the object which is a valid class in the CSS file.
Data type: String |
|||
ID | Specifies the identifier of the object, which must be unique in the report. The ID property can be a style sheet selector.
Data type: String |
|||
Style | The property can be used in two ways.
Data type: String |
|||
Others | ||||
Export to CSV | Specifies whether to include the object when exporting the report to CSV.
Data type: Boolean |
|||
Export to Excel | Specifies whether to include the object when exporting the report to Excel.
Data type: Boolean |
|||
Invisible | Specifies whether to show the object in the design area and in the report results. All formulas and calculations will still be performed if the property is set to true.
Data type: Boolean |
|||
Excel | ||||
Column Index | Specifies the X coordinate of the object relative to its parent container when exported to Excel or CSV, measured in cells. The Columned property at the report level must be set to true for this property to take effect.
Data type: Integer |
|||
Row Index | Specifies the Y coordinate of the object relative to its parent container when exported to Excel or CSV, measured in cells. The Columned property at the report level must be set to true for this property to take effect.
Data type: Integer |
|||
Border | ||||
Border Color | Specifies the color of the border of the object. Choose a color from the drop-down list, enter a hexadecimal RGB value (for example, 0xCCAA00), or select Custom from the drop-down list to specify the color.
Data type: String |
|||
Border Thickness | Specifies the width of the border in inches or centimeters. Enter a numeric value to change the thickness.
Data type: Float |
|||
Bottom Line | Specifies the line style of the bottom border of the object. Choose a style from the drop-down list.
Data type: Enumeration |
|||
Left Line | Specifies the line style of the left border of the object. Choose a style from the drop-down list.
Data type: Enumeration |
|||
Right Line | Specifies the line style of the right border of the object. Choose a style from the drop-down list.
Data type: Enumeration |
|||
Top Line | Specifies the line style of the top border of the object. Choose a style from the drop-down list.
Data type: Enumeration |
|||
Title | ||||
Background | Specifies the background color of the title bar. Choose a color from the drop-down list, enter a hexadecimal RGB value (for example, 0xff0000), or select Custom from the drop-down list to specify the color.
Data type: String |
|||
Bold | Specifies whether to make the text bold in the title bar.
Data type: Boolean |
|||
Font Face | Specifies the font of the text in the title bar. Choose an option from the drop-down list.
Data type: Enumeration |
|||
Font Size | Specifies the font size of the text in the title bar. Enter an integer value to change the size.
Data type: Integer |
|||
Foreground | Specifies the foreground color of the title bar. Choose a color from the drop-down list, enter a hexadecimal RGB value (for example, 0xff0000), or select Custom from the drop-down list to specify the color.
Data type: String |
|||
Horizontal Alignment | Specifies the horizontal justification of the text in the title bar. Choose an option from the drop-down list.
Data type: Enumeration |
|||
Italic | Specifies whether to make the text italic in the title bar.
Data type: Boolean |
|||
Map Name | Specifies whether to use the name of the DBField added to the filter contorl as the text displayed in the title bar.
Data type: Boolean |
|||
Show Title | Specifies whether to show the title bar. It is meanful to set all the other properties in the Title category when this property is set to true.
Data type: Boolean |
|||
Text | Specifies the text displayed in the title bar. This property can be edited only when Map Name is set to false. Enter a string to change the text.
Data type: String |
|||
Underline | Specifies whether to underline the text in the title bar.
Data type: Boolean |
|||
Text Format | ||||
Bold | Specifies whether to make the text bold.
Data type: Boolean |
|||
Font Face | Specifies the font of the text. Choose an option from the drop-down list.
Data type: Enumeration |
|||
Font Size | Specifies the font size of the text. Enter an integer value to change the size.
Data type: Integer |
|||
Format | Specifies the display format of the text in the report result. It varies with data type and can be manually defined.
Data type: String Note: For the BigDecimal type, to avoid precision loss, you should enter a prefix JRD when setting the format property value. |
|||
Italic | Specifies whether to make the text italic.
Data type: Boolean |
|||
Underline | Specifies whether to underline the text.
Data type: Boolean |